April 20, 2018: SOAP #3060: 1Samuel 23; Psalm 31,54; Matthew 7

Scripture:  Psalm (NIV) 31:19 How great is your goodness, which you have stored up for those who fear you, which you bestow in the sight of men on those who take refuge in you.
20 In the shelter of your presence you hide them from the intrigues of men; in your dwelling you keep them safe from accusing tongues.

Observation:   Verse 19 makes me think that God has a plan to give me special goodness.  He has abundant goodness just because that is who He is.  But He has goodness stored up specifically for me.  He knows what I will be needing, and has the right goodness just waiting for me.

Application:   It is good for me to hide the thoughts of those against me among the many thoughts of Him who is for me!   When God’s thoughts are hidden among the thoughts of the world, I am in trouble.

Prayer:    Holy Spirit, help me to meditate on God’s thoughts about me.  Help me keep my mind so full of God’s thoughts that there just is not any room or time for Satan’s thoughts.  Amen
